4.0.0

In earlier versions of mock-fs, a monkey-patched version of the fs module was used to provide an in-memory filesystem. With each major release of Node, the mock-fs package needed to include a modified copy of the fs module. With the mock-fs@4 release, this package no longer includes a modified copy of the fs module. Instead, this package overrides process.binding('fs'). While this is not part of Node's stable API, it has proven to be a more stable interface than the fs module itself (based on experience implementing it with Node 0.8 through 7.0).

Upgrading from 3.x to 4.0 should be straightforward for most applications. There are several breaking changes that may be restored in future releases:

  • The mock.fs() function has been removed.
  • The object created by fs.stat() and friends is no longer an instance of fs.Stats (though it behaves as one).
  • Lazy require() calls do not work consistently.

Detailed changes:

  • Only override process.binding('fs') (#182)
  • Expose the root of the mocked filesystem (thanks @ciaranj, see #194)
